ELIGIBILITY CRITERIA:
Candidates should have passed Karnataka 2nd PUC / 12th standard or equivalent examination recognized by AICTE and State Government in Physics and Mathematics subjects along with Chemistry / Electronics / Biology / Biotechnology / Computer Science as optional subjects and English as one of the languages of study. Students must have obtained a minimum of 45% marks in aggregate (40% for SC/ST/OBC).
ADMISSION GUIDELINES:
The candidate must have also qualified in one of the following entrance exams: CET/ COMED-K / JEE / AIEEE.
